Maple Slice Reviews was founded in 2022 with a simple premise: pizza is Canada's most popular takeout food, yet there was no dedicated, independent resource helping Canadians navigate the thousands of pizzerias across the country. Restaurant review platforms cast a wide net, covering everything from sushi to steakhouses. We wanted to go deep on pizza — and only pizza.
Our editorial team visits pizzerias anonymously, paying for every meal out of our own budget. We never accept complimentary meals, sponsorships, or advertising from the restaurants we review. This independence is the foundation of everything we do. When we say a pizzeria's cheese blend is exceptional or their crust falls flat, you can trust that it's our honest assessment.

We're also deeply committed to celebrating Canada's diverse pizza culture. From Montreal's unique thick-crusted, loaded-to-the-edge style to the artisan sourdough movement in Ontario's cottage country, Canadian pizza has its own identity — and it deserves recognition.
